Abstract
We propose a new bit-detection method which is applicable to high-density, d=1 optical recording systems. The new method combines the advantages of computational simplicity, non-recursive operations, as well as performance which approaches that of maximum likelihood sequence detection (MLSD), even at very high recording densities.
